diff options
author | Peter Simons | 2018-01-02 17:41:39 +0100 |
---|---|---|
committer | GitHub | 2018-01-02 17:41:39 +0100 |
commit | c98eb9e9b982a33d00bb5ab7da8d646c63912e8e (patch) | |
tree | 505b193101d792c3c701bdac5bdda00ebfed955f | |
parent | bc5bf958580c7de14acd9e94e95d0e23126bf8fe (diff) | |
parent | 34a91b79220cf54bce20db52cf2d5775ccc5e611 (diff) |
Merge pull request #33333 from shlevy/haskell-internal-libs-darwin
haskell: Fix depending on libs with internal libs on darwin.
-rw-r--r-- | pkgs/development/haskell-modules/generic-builder.nix |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/pkgs/development/haskell-modules/generic-builder.nix b/pkgs/development/haskell-modules/generic-builder.nix index c633310a37a4..e4ae24f74fab 100644 --- a/pkgs/development/haskell-modules/generic-builder.nix +++ b/pkgs/development/haskell-modules/generic-builder.nix @@ -243,7 +243,7 @@ stdenv.mkDerivation ({ # libraries) from all the dependencies. local dynamicLinksDir="$out/lib/links" mkdir -p $dynamicLinksDir - for d in $(grep dynamic-library-dirs "$packageConfDir/"*|awk '{print $2}'); do + for d in $(grep dynamic-library-dirs "$packageConfDir/"*|awk '{print $2}'|sort -u); do ln -s "$d/"*.dylib $dynamicLinksDir done # Edit the local package DB to reference the links directory. |